Postdoctoral fellowship at University of Minnesota

| | Comments (0)

The University of Minnesota invite applications for a Postdoctoral Fellowship in Adolescent Psychology to begin Sept 2005. Clinical work focuses on adolescent eating disorders and obesity, as well as other concomitant mental health disorders including anxiety, depression, chronic illnesses, & family problems. The position is 50-60% clinical with the remainder split between seminars & research experiences. Fellowships are one to two years. Stipend is $36,400 + benefits. Applicants must have a Ph.D. or Psy.D. Application deadline is Feb 15, 2005
